- The distance between Gyzyletrek, Turkmenistan and Geilo, Norway is approximately 4,107 km or 2,552 mi.
- To reach Gyzyletrek in this distance one would set out from Geilo bearing 106.8°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Gyzyletrek bearing 143.5° or SE .
- Gyzyletrek has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k) whereas Geilo has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Gyzyletrek is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Geilo is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The average temperature is 16 °C (28.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.6 °C (2.9°F) more in Gyzyletrek.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 404 mm (15.9 in) less which is equivalent to 404 l/m² (9.92 US gal/ft²) or 4,040,000 l/ha (431,903 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.9° higher in Gyzyletrek than in Geilo.
- Relative humidity levels are 2.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 14.5°C (26.2°F) higher.
